    Let's try getting a minidump to the Apple Engineers for a look.
    To set up your machine to capture a minidump, right click on "My Computer", select "Properties", select the "Advanced" tab, select the "Startup and Recovery" Settings button, select "small memory dump" from the popup. When it crashes, look for the MiniDump file. It's usually in the folder "C:\WINDOWS\Minidump" and is called something like Mini<number>-<number>.dmp.
    Generate the crash, collect the minidump, and send it as an attachment to this email address
    in the email to Roy, be sure to include the following information:
    - A link to the thread on Apple Discussions where the issue is being discussed
    - The username you are using in the thread
    - The version of iTunes you are using or trying to use
    - the version of Windows you are using (mention service packs)
    - A concise description of the issue you are seeing
    - The exact text of the error message you are seeing

  • IPhone causes Windows XP to crash when connected: This is the solution...

    I've the solution to the problem....!!!
    This message is in response to a problem reported originally by swinglinestapler on jul 2, 2007.
    Like others before me have said, there is a conflict between logitech camera drivers and the iphone (when there are photos in the camera roll).
    To solve the problem you MUST:
    1.- Unistall the logitech camera from your system (using the uninstall option from logitech appl); restart your system.
    2.- Connect your iphone (make sure you have some photos in the camera roll)
    3.- Wait until the system recognize the camera on the iphone.
    4.- Go to device manager and update the driver for the iphone camera; if you open "my computer" it will show a camera icon with the name "Apple iphone #5"
    5.- DO NOT UNPLUG the iphone from your computer
    6.- Re-install the logitech camera; it's better if you go to the logitech website and download the latest software, rather then using the one that came with your camera.
    You're DONE!
    Now you can unplug your iphone, take as many pictures as you want and your system will not crash when you plug the iphone again to it.

  • Re: iPhone causes Windows XP to crash when connected

    I too am having this issue, but do not have a logitech web cam installed.
    Vista Ultimate and XP both die if I dock the iphone with pictures in it.

    docnzok,
    This issue can occur because of a conflict with other devices drivers. Even if those devices are not currently installed. While the Logitech Webcam is one many users have reported, it and others are discussed in this article:
    http://docs.info.apple.com/article.html?artnum=306048
    Even if you don't currently have a device attached, it may have drivers left behind.
    Do you have a media card reader, for example to read the memory cards from a digital camera? Do you have a scanner attached?
    If you remove the pictures you have taken on the iPhone, for example after emailing them to yourself, does the same issue occur?
    Thank you,
    Nathan C.

    A BSOD situation normally indicates something is wrong systemicly with the computer. It can be either software (usually OS), or hardware related.
    The first thing that I would do would be to gather all info on your system and list full OS, version, updates, etc., and all hardware specs. Something in those lists might provide a clue.
    Next, I'd look carefully at Event Viewer, especially at the System and Applications tabs. Look for yellow warning messages at the time of the BSOD, and especially the red error messages. It might be easier to invoke a BSOD, so you will know the exact time and date of the crash. Study each yellow and each red message carefully. Many might not yield much useful info, but some might tell you a lot of about what is happening, and may even give you the cause. Please explore every link that is offered in each of these messages. They should take you to either the MS site, or to the site of a software, or hardware company. These will likely be where you'll gather the most important data.
    Here's what to look for in Event Viewer:
